Many couples are having to downsize their big weddings, but by doing this really has it’s plus points! Emily styled 4 tables, full of her gorgeous flowers and plants, providing inspiration for smaller weddings. The first being this gorgeous colour pop!
Micro weddings have a more personal and intimate feel. The wedding breakfast tables also feel like this, everyone is together and you can chat and speak to everyone you have invited. You can also splash out on some of the things you may have cut back on – like flowers! Lining tables full of bright flowers, creates a unique and effective look perfect for an intimate wedding.
This table could work in both winter and summer.. I tend to find people stick to certain colours in the autumn/winter. But there’s nothing to say you can’t have bright and bold colours. Adding a few candles for a more cosy winter feel would be a fabulous look when the nights draw in.
Emily and I want to emphasise that smaller doesn’t mean less. You can continue to have the wedding of your dreams even if the guest list is slightly smaller.
